§ 6272. Possession of Authorization.
0.2K chars
Each person making an application of a pesticide under a research authorization shall have a copy of the authorization available at the use site at the time of the application.

§ 895. Branding Positions.
0.3K chars
In the enforcement of Division 10, Chapter 4, Article 1, relating to the branding of cattle, there shall be six branding positions for the recordation of identification brands. Such positions shall include the shoulder, ribs and hip on each side of the animal.
§ 1496. Financial Responsibility of Applicants.
0.2K chars
Applicants for license as horse owner or trainer must submit satisfactory evidence of their financial stability and their ability to care for and maintain the horses owned and/or trained by them when such evidence is requested by the Board.

§ 1764. Appearance at Hearing upon Appeal.
0.3K chars
The Board shall notify the appellant, the stewards and all licensees or other persons affected by decision under appeal of the date, time and location of its hearing in the matter. The burden shall be on the appellant to prove the facts necessary to sustain the appeal.

§ 1562. Duties of Associate Judges.
0.2K chars
An associate judge may perform any of the duties which are performed by any racing official at a meeting, provided such duties are assigned or delegated to him by the Board or by the stewards presiding at that meeting.
